I have another question that I saw at the 58e vs. 4th scrim today.
The 58e was running two officers, and the one in the back not currently leading was shot, is that officer aim? Why or why not?
I would consider it officer aim. A lot of regiments these days use the "reverse march" command where the officer in the back would immediately take charge of the line, so both of the officers are leading the line during a round.
